Jeff Johnson is a political motivator and social commentator speaking to baby boomers, the Hip-Hop generation and to Generation Y – the leaders of today and yesterday. He has a long history for rallying the troops stemming from his days at the University of Toledo when he became the first person of color to be the President of Student Government. Upon graduation he headed to Washington, DC and was the National Director for the NAACP’s Youth and College Division, and then was later tapped by Russell Simmons to be the Vice President for the Hip-Hop Summit Action Network. Involved in student leadership for nearly 10 years, Patrick offers inspiration and practical advice for student leadership organizations and school assemblies. Patrick served as a student leader while in middle school, high school, and college. He is recipient of the Miami Herald's Silver Knight Award for speech and was elected the University of West Alabama's Senator-at-Large. As one of the youngest professional speakers in America, Patrick showcased for the National Association of Student Councils. Since then, he has presented for many state leadership organizations. Mr. Cromwell continued his leadership efforts in law school serving as class president, associate editor of the law review, and was honored, by his peers, as Thurgood Marshall 3L Student of the Year for his scholastic and leadership contributions to the University.  He later graduated, with honors, with a Juris Doctorate from Texas Southern University.  After graduation, Mr. Cromwell served as a federal law clerk in U.S. Federal District Court in the Southern District of Texas (Houston Division) and worked as an associate at a prominent intellectual property law firm in Washington, D.C.  He later founded and is currently CEO of The Harbor Institute, a company based out of Washington D.C that empowers minority students to excel. Kimberly Campbell is an entrepreneur, strategy consultant and speaker/facilitator.  She is the founder of New Venture Consulting Group (NVCG), a business strategy consulting firm that assists minority entrepreneurs in securing the finances required to grow viable business ventures.  Kimberly holds an MBA from the Darden Business School at the University of Virginia.

Kimberly has an extensive a career as a Management Consultant working with Accenture and with the Wharton Small Business Development Center (SBDC).  She has advised both fortune 500 and small business clients. As a Management Consultant with Accenture, Kimberly worked with strategy teams to improve business processes for clients in the government and financial services industries. At Wharton SBDC, Ms. Campbell led an initiative to redesign the business consulting process and improved the Center’s state ranking of “Most Effective SBDC in Pennsylvania” from sixteenth to fourth.  Read More...
